2008 October No.58 – TRADE AGREEMENTS


58. Which of the following statements regarding the Generalized System of Preferences (GSP) is true?

A. GSP is a trade program reserved for countries that export a majority of their originating goods to the U.S.

B. GSP is a “unilateral” trade program, in that the countries which are granted special treatment for imports into the U.S. do not reciprocate

C. The special program indicator (SPI) “A*” is reserved for the “least- developed beneficiary developing countries” (LDBDC)

D. GSP is one of the newest trade programs to be put into effect

E. Because it was one of the first trade programs to be instituted, GSP did not include an expiration date in the presidential proclamation and therefore is not subject to periodic renewal by Congress

The Answer is: B

Citation: 19 CFR 10.171; HTS General Note 4
